How Much Water Should You Drink During Exercise?

On average, you need to drink 8 ounces of fluid or 240 milliliters of fluid every hour from the time you wake up until 10 hours later./nIf you are exercising, you need to drink additional fluids to maximize the effects of the exercise and avoid dehydration./nThe Galpin equation, which is a simple formula for how much fluid to ingest on average, is based on your body weight in pounds and can be translated into the metric system as 2 milliliters of water per kilogram of body weight every 15 to 20 minutes.
